The North Eastern Railway is transforming Daliganj Junction in Lucknow into a high-tech transport hub under the Amrit Bharat Station Scheme. With a total investment of approximately 28.45 crore, the station is undergoing a complete makeover to provide passengers with modern amenities similar to those found at airports. This project aims to cater to the growing passenger traffic and enhance the overall travel experience in the Lucknow division.
What are the new facilities available at Daliganj Junction?
The redevelopment plan focuses on upgrading the core infrastructure to international standards. A significant highlight of the project is the construction of a 12-meter wide foot over bridge designed to ensure smooth passenger movement across platforms. The station now features an attractive facade and a redesigned station building covering 608 square meters. Passengers will have access to air-conditioned waiting rooms, modern ticket counters, and improved sanitation facilities.
- New 12-meter wide foot over bridge for better connectivity
- Granite flooring across 5,000 square meters of platform area
- Modern waiting halls and clean toilet blocks
- One lift and two escalators currently under installation
- Advanced signage and digital train display boards
Project status and development milestones
The Lucknow Division of North Eastern Railway has completed a major portion of the work, including the circulating area, drainage systems, and parking zones. As of April 2026, the station building and porch work are finished, and the second entry point is being developed to reduce congestion. While the platform extension and beautification are done, the technical installation of lifts and escalators is reaching its final stage.
| Work Component | Current Status |
|---|---|
| Circulating Area and Parking | Completed |
| Platform Surface Upgradation | Completed |
| 12m Foot Over Bridge | Final Stages |
| Station Facade Beautification | Completed |
| Lifts and Escalators | In Progress |
